Polski

Poznaj podstawy komputerów kwantowych, ich potencjalny wpływ na różne branże i wyzwania. Dowiedz się o kubitach, superpozycji, splątaniu i algorytmach kwantowych.

Podstawy Komputerów Kwantowych: Zrozumienie Przyszłości Obliczeń

Komputery kwantowe reprezentują zmianę paradygmatu w dziedzinie obliczeń, wykraczając poza klasyczne bity, które stanowią podstawę współczesnych komputerów, aby wykorzystać zasady mechaniki kwantowej. Chociaż wciąż w powijakach, komputery kwantowe mają potencjał zrewolucjonizowania branż, od medycyny i materiałoznawstwa po finanse i sztuczną inteligencję. Ten post na blogu zawiera kompleksowy przegląd podstawowych koncepcji komputerów kwantowych, ich potencjalnych zastosowań i wyzwań, przed którymi stoją badacze, aby urzeczywistnić tę technologię.

Czym są Komputery Kwantowe?

Komputery klasyczne przechowują informacje jako bity, które mogą być albo 0, albo 1. Komputery kwantowe z kolei używają kubitów (bitów kwantowych). Kubity wykorzystują zjawiska mechaniki kwantowej, takie jak superpozycja i splątanie, do wykonywania obliczeń w sposób fundamentalnie niemożliwy dla komputerów klasycznych.

Superpozycja: Bycie w Wielu Stanach Naraz

Superpozycja pozwala kubitowi istnieć w kombinacji zarówno 0, jak i 1 jednocześnie. Wyobraź sobie monetę obracającą się w powietrzu – nie jest ani orłem, ani reszką, dopóki nie wyląduje. Podobnie, kubit w superpozycji jest w probabilistycznym stanie zarówno 0, jak i 1. Pozwala to komputerom kwantowym badać ogromną liczbę możliwości jednocześnie, prowadząc do wykładniczego przyspieszenia dla niektórych rodzajów obliczeń.

Przykład: Rozważmy symulację zachowania cząsteczki. Komputer klasyczny musiałby testować każdą możliwą konfigurację indywidualnie. Komputer kwantowy, wykorzystując superpozycję, może badać wszystkie konfiguracje jednocześnie, potencjalnie znajdując optymalną konfigurację znacznie szybciej. Ma to znaczące implikacje dla odkrywania leków i materiałoznawstwa.

Splątanie: Upiorne Działanie na Odległość

Splątanie to dziwne zjawisko, w którym dwa lub więcej kubitów zostaje ze sobą powiązanych w taki sposób, że stan jednego kubitu natychmiast wpływa na stan drugiego, niezależnie od odległości, która je dzieli. Einstein nazwał to słynnym "upiornym działaniem na odległość".

Przykład: Wyobraź sobie dwa splątane kubity. Jeśli zmierzysz stan jednego kubitu i okaże się, że jest on 0, natychmiast wiesz, że drugi kubit będzie w stanie 1, nawet jeśli dzieli je odległość lat świetlnych. To wzajemne połączenie ma kluczowe znaczenie dla niektórych algorytmów kwantowych i protokołów komunikacji kwantowej.

Kluczowe Koncepcje w Komputerach Kwantowych

Kubity a Bity

Fundamentalna różnica między komputerami klasycznymi i kwantowymi polega na jednostce informacji: bitu kontra kubitowi. Bit może być tylko 0 lub 1, podczas gdy kubit może istnieć w superpozycji obu stanów jednocześnie. Ta pozornie niewielka różnica prowadzi do ogromnych korzyści obliczeniowych dla niektórych problemów.

Analogia: Pomyśl o włączniku światła (bit), który może być albo WŁĄCZONY (1), albo WYŁĄCZONY (0). Kubit z kolei jest jak ściemniacz, który może być jednocześnie w kombinacji WŁĄCZONY i WYŁĄCZONY.

Bramki Kwantowe

Tak jak komputery klasyczne używają bramek logicznych (AND, OR, NOT) do manipulowania bitami, komputery kwantowe używają bramek kwantowych do manipulowania kubitami. Bramki kwantowe to operacje matematyczne, które zmieniają stan kubitu lub grupy kubitów. Przykłady obejmują bramkę Hadamarda, która umieszcza kubit w superpozycji, i bramkę CNOT, która tworzy splątanie między kubitami.

Algorytmy Kwantowe

Algorytmy kwantowe to specyficzne sekwencje bramek kwantowych zaprojektowane do rozwiązywania konkretnych problemów obliczeniowych. Dwa z najbardziej znanych algorytmów kwantowych to:

Potencjalne Zastosowania Komputerów Kwantowych

Potencjalne zastosowania komputerów kwantowych są ogromne i obejmują wiele branż:

Odkrywanie Leków i Materiałoznawstwo

Komputery kwantowe mogą symulować zachowanie cząsteczek i materiałów z niespotykaną dotąd dokładnością. Może to przyspieszyć odkrywanie nowych leków, projektowanie nowych materiałów o określonych właściwościach i optymalizację procesów chemicznych. Na przykład badacze mogliby użyć symulacji kwantowych do zaprojektowania nowego katalizatora do wychwytywania dwutlenku węgla lub do opracowania bardziej skutecznego leku na raka.

Globalny Przykład: Firmy farmaceutyczne w Szwajcarii badają symulacje kwantowe w celu identyfikacji potencjalnych kandydatów na leki na chorobę Alzheimera. Jednocześnie grupy badawcze w Japonii używają komputerów kwantowych do projektowania nowych materiałów akumulatorowych o zwiększonej gęstości energii.

Finanse

Komputery kwantowe mogą optymalizować portfele inwestycyjne, wykrywać fałszywe transakcje i ulepszać strategie zarządzania ryzykiem. Można ich również użyć do opracowania dokładniejszych modeli wyceny złożonych instrumentów finansowych.

Globalny Przykład: Banki w Singapurze eksperymentują z algorytmami kwantowymi, aby ulepszyć systemy wykrywania oszustw. Fundusze hedgingowe w Londynie używają komputerów kwantowych do optymalizacji strategii handlowych.

Sztuczna Inteligencja

Komputery kwantowe mogą przyspieszyć algorytmy uczenia maszynowego, prowadząc do przełomów w takich obszarach, jak rozpoznawanie obrazów, przetwarzanie języka naturalnego i robotyka. Można ich również użyć do opracowania nowych typów algorytmów sztucznej inteligencji, których nie można uruchomić na komputerach klasycznych.

Globalny Przykład: Laboratoria badawcze AI w Kanadzie badają kwantowe algorytmy uczenia maszynowego do rozpoznawania obrazów. Firmy technologiczne w USA badają wykorzystanie komputerów kwantowych do trenowania większych i bardziej złożonych sieci neuronowych.

Kryptografia

Podczas gdy algorytm Shora stanowi zagrożenie dla obecnych metod szyfrowania, komputery kwantowe oferują również potencjał dla nowych, bezpieczniejszych systemów kryptograficznych. Kwantowa dystrybucja klucza (QKD) wykorzystuje zasady mechaniki kwantowej do tworzenia kluczy szyfrujących, które są udowodnione jako bezpieczne przed podsłuchem.

Globalny Przykład: Rządy w Chinach intensywnie inwestują w infrastrukturę QKD, aby zabezpieczyć swoją komunikację. Firmy w Europie opracowują algorytmy szyfrowania odporne na ataki kwantowe, aby chronić się przed przyszłymi atakami ze strony komputerów kwantowych.

Wyzwania w Komputerach Kwantowych

Pomimo ogromnego potencjału, komputery kwantowe stoją przed poważnymi wyzwaniami:

Dekoherecja

Dekoherecja to utrata informacji kwantowej spowodowana interakcjami z otoczeniem. Kubity są niezwykle wrażliwe na szumy i zakłócenia, które mogą powodować utratę superpozycji i splątania, prowadząc do błędów w obliczeniach. Utrzymanie delikatnych stanów kwantowych kubitów przez wystarczająco długi czas jest główną przeszkodą.

Skalowalność

Budowa komputera kwantowego z dużą liczbą kubitów jest niezwykle trudna. Obecne komputery kwantowe mają tylko kilkaset kubitów, czyli znacznie mniej niż miliony lub miliardy kubitów potrzebnych do rozwiązania wielu rzeczywistych problemów. Zwiększenie liczby kubitów przy jednoczesnym zachowaniu ich jakości i stabilności jest poważnym wyzwaniem inżynieryjnym.

Korekcja Błędów

Komputery kwantowe są podatne na błędy z powodu dekoherecji i innych czynników. Kwantowa korekcja błędów to zestaw technik używanych do wykrywania i korygowania tych błędów. Opracowanie skutecznych kodów kwantowej korekcji błędów jest niezbędne do budowy komputerów kwantowych odpornych na błędy.

Tworzenie Oprogramowania

Tworzenie oprogramowania dla komputerów kwantowych wymaga zupełnie innego sposobu myślenia niż programowanie klasyczne. Potrzebne są nowe języki programowania, algorytmy i narzędzia, aby w pełni wykorzystać potencjał komputerów kwantowych. Istnieje globalny niedobór wykwalifikowanych programistów oprogramowania kwantowego.

Różne Podejścia do Budowy Komputerów Kwantowych

Badanych jest kilka różnych technologii do budowy komputerów kwantowych, każda z własnymi zaletami i wadami:

Supremacja Kwantowa i Dalej

Supremacja kwantowa odnosi się do punktu, w którym komputer kwantowy może wykonać obliczenia, których żaden komputer klasyczny nie jest w stanie wykonać w rozsądnym czasie. W 2019 roku Google ogłosił, że osiągnął supremację kwantową dzięki swojemu procesorowi Sycamore, ale to twierdzenie zostało zakwestionowane przez niektórych badaczy.

Chociaż osiągnięcie supremacji kwantowej jest znaczącym kamieniem milowym, ważne jest, aby pamiętać, że to dopiero początek. Prawdziwa obietnica komputerów kwantowych polega na ich zdolności do rozwiązywania rzeczywistych problemów, które są obecnie nierozwiązywalne dla komputerów klasycznych. Wymaga to budowy większych, bardziej stabilnych i bardziej odpornych na błędy komputerów kwantowych.

Przyszłość Komputerów Kwantowych

Komputery kwantowe są wciąż we wczesnej fazie rozwoju, ale mają potencjał przekształcenia wielu aspektów naszego życia. W ciągu następnej dekady możemy spodziewać się znaczących postępów w sprzęcie kwantowym, oprogramowaniu i algorytmach. Wraz z tym, jak komputery kwantowe staną się potężniejsze i bardziej dostępne, będą wykorzystywane do rozwiązywania coraz bardziej złożonych problemów w szerokim zakresie branż.

Praktyczne Wskazówki:

Komputery kwantowe to nie tylko rewolucja technologiczna; to zmiana paradygmatu, która przekształci przyszłość obliczeń i nasz świat. Rozumiejąc podstawy komputerów kwantowych i ich potencjalne zastosowania, możemy przygotować się na ekscytujące możliwości i wyzwania, które nas czekają.

Wnioski

Komputery kwantowe to transformacyjna technologia, która ma zrewolucjonizować wiele sektorów na całym świecie. Podczas gdy wyzwania pozostają w skalowalności, korekcji błędów i tworzeniu oprogramowania, potencjalne korzyści są ogromne. Od odkrywania leków w Europie i materiałoznawstwa w Azji po modelowanie finansowe w Ameryce Północnej i bezpieczną komunikację na całym świecie, wpływ komputerów kwantowych będzie odczuwalny na wszystkich kontynentach. Wraz z przyspieszeniem badań i rozwoju, zrozumienie podstaw komputerów kwantowych staje się coraz bardziej kluczowe dla profesjonalistów i organizacji pragnących wykorzystać to potężne nowe narzędzie.